Abstract:
|
Business surveys are designed using imperfect frames. Some of these imperfections include improper classification of the businesses (size, indusry, region), duplication, time lags between the appearance of a business on the frame, and its physical startup. The subject of the roundtable discussion will be here to discuss sampling and estimation procedures for countering these negative impacts.
